Trocard Cabernet Rose 2011
Bordeaux, France 
Cash Price $8.99

Ripe Strawberry and Red Cherry dance into notes of bees honey and fresh meadow flowers.  Notes of Rose petals and tart cranberry tickle the taste buds with clean acids.

Hill Company ‘Little Rascal’s’ Sauvignon Blanc 2011
Napa Valley, California
Cash Price $9.99

Freshly cut grass sings into notes of guava and stone fruits.  Notes of lemon citrus sing through zesty acids.  Awesome Summer White!

Marques de la Concordia Tempranillo 2011
Rioja, Spain
Cash Price $8.99
 
I have been enamored by this winery for many years and am completely impressed with their new offering.  Black Plum and Currant sink into smidgeon of vanilla and cedar. This is the next Big Table Wine Red!
